HAYSVILLE – The Haysville City Council at its Nov. 12 meeting authorized the city to apply for the Kansas Small Cities Community Development Block Grant (CDBG), which would help low- to moderate- income Haysville residents with home rehabilitation.

CHENEY – Concluding a months-long negotiation process with Sedgwick County, the Cheney City Council last Thursday voted to annex portions of three roadways into the city limits. Ordinance 959 gives a legal description for 14 different tracts.

GODDARD – The Goddard City Council on Monday approved a resolution of intent on single hauler waste and recycling. The resolution of intent (ROI) does not mean the city will adopt a single- hauler system, but it does allow the city to continue the process of moving toward that option.
